What to Look for in a Conservatory Installer


Selecting the best conservatory installer is essential to the overall success of your project. Here are essential factors to think about when examining potential installers:

  1. Experience and Expertise

    • Look for installers with a wealth of experience and knowledge particularly associated to conservatories.
    • Examine their portfolio to see examples of previous tasks comparable to your vision.
  2. Accreditations and Certifications

    • Inspect if the installer belongs to acknowledged trade associations such as FENSA or CERTASS.
    • These endorsements typically signify adherence to quality standards and policies.
  3. Consumer Reviews and Testimonials

    • Check out evaluations on platforms like Google, Trustpilot, or the company's own website.
    • Look for testimonials from previous clients to determine their fulfillment.
  4. Insurance and Warranty

    • Make sure the installer has liability insurance, which safeguards both parties when it comes to accidents.
    • Ask about the service warranty coverage that comes with their installations, as this can differ considerably.
  5. Pricing Transparency

    • Acquiring quotes from several installers can help you understand the average prices in your area.
    • Watch out for quotes that appear considerably lower than the competitors, as they may not include all required expenses.
  6. Job Management Skills

    • A reliable installer needs to have strong job management abilities, ensuring timelines are followed which the job runs smoothly.

Steps to the Installation Process


As soon as you have actually chosen a conservatory installer, you can expect the following steps in the installation process:

  1. Initial Consultation

    • The installer will visit your home to discuss your vision and collect requirements for the job.
  2. Design and Planning

    • The installer will develop design plans and outline the required permits and guidelines.
  3. Product Selection

    • Choosing the right materials— such as glass type, frames, and roofing— is essential and will typically be recommended by the installer.
  4. Preparation and Foundations

    • Before construction starts, the site will require to be prepared, which may consist of laying structures.
  5. Construction and Installation

    • The main installation stage will occur, throughout which the conservatory structure is constructed.
  6. Completing Touches

    • After the primary installation, finishing components such as lighting, floor covering, and decors can be carried out.
  7. Inspection and Sign-Off

    • Lastly, a comprehensive examination makes sure everything satisfies quality standards before the task is signed off.

Q1: How long does it take to build a conservatory?

A: Construction timelines vary, but a typical conservatory installation can take anywhere from a few weeks to a few months, depending upon the complexity and size of the job.

Q2: What is the best type of conservatory for my home?

A: The best type typically depends on your home's architectural style and your intended usage for space. Choices consist of Victorian, Edwardian, Lean-to, and Gable conservatories.

Q3: How can I fund my conservatory task?

A: Many installers use financing options, so it's worthwhile to ask about payment plans. Additionally, house owners might think about individual loans or credit options.

Q5: What maintenance is required for a conservatory?

A: Routine maintenance often consists of cleansing frames and glass, examining seals, and checking for damage. This can assist guarantee longevity and functionality.
